Sheladia Associates is Hiring a Lead Engineer Near Rockville, MD

Company Description

Sheladia Associates, Inc. (Sheladia), a minority-owned business established in 1974, is an engineering and architecture firm supporting U.S. government, state and county projects, as well as U.S. funded international projects and multi-lateral donor bank and host-country funded projects.

Job Description

Sheladia is seeking a highly skilled and experienced senior-level Engineer to lead our domestic engineering department. As a senior-level professional, you will be responsible for managing Sheladia’s domestic engineering team and overseeing the design, development, and implementation of engineering projects.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ams, including architects, contractors, and government agencies, to ensure successful project execution. This is a full-time, fully on-site position.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Lead and manage a team of multi-disciplined engineers (civil, structural, stormwater, transportation, etc.), providing guidance, mentoring, and technical expertise.
  • Oversee the planning, design, and execution of engineering projects, ensuring compliance with regulations, codes, and standards.
  •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to define project objectives, scope, and deliverables.
  • Manage project budgets, schedules, and resources to ensure successful project completion within specified timelines and budgetary constraints.
  • Conduct feasibility studies, risk assessments, and cost-benefit analyses to support project decision-making.
  • Review and approve engineering designs, calculations, and technical documents.
  • Ensure adherence to safety protocols and promote a culture of safety within the team.
  • Monitor project progress, identify potential issues, and implement corrective actions as needed.
  • Foster client relationships and actively participate in business development activities, including proposal writing and client presentations.
  • Other duties as needed.

Qualifications

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ering required; Master's degree is preferred.
  • Minimum of 12 years (10 years with Master’s degree) relevant experience in engineering project management, with a focus on design, construction, and infrastructure development.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license is required.
  • Strong knowledge of civil engineering principles, codes, regulations, and best practices.
  • Proficiency in industry-standard software and tools, such as AutoCAD, Civil 3D, and project management software.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et deadlines.
  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making capabilities.
  • Proven track record of successfully delivering civil engineering projects on time and within budget.
  • PMP certification preferred but not required.

About Sheladia Associates

Sheladia Associates, Inc. is a minority-owned and operated multidisciplinary consulting firm founded in 1974 and headquartered in the metropolitan Washington DC area, with international offices located in Afghanistan, Ethiopia, India, Indonesia, Kenya, Pakistan, Philippines, and Zambia. We are experienced in Structures and Facilities, Transportation Infrastructure, Energy, Rural Development, and Water Resources & Sanitation. We design and build infrastructure worldwide both physical and institutional to support economic growth and strengthen the capabilities of our clients and partners. Shel ... adia provides project development services that include economic and financial analysis, policy design and institutional strengthening, planning and feasibility studies, detailed engineering design, environmental and social studies, procurement assistance and management, maintenance planning and management, construction supervision/management, and monitoring and evaluation. In the international arena, Sheladia provides technical assistance to governments, their agencies, and private sector entities to strengthen and support institutional capabilities through organizational development, technology transfer, and training.
